Setting a Competitive Price

To establish a competitive price for your mobile home in Elk Grove, start by researching recent sales of similar properties in the area. This provides you with a benchmark and helps you grasp the local market trends. Don't forget to take into account the age, condition, and location of your mobile home. These factors can greatly impact its value.

When I wanted to sell my mobile home, I made a note of any upgrades or renovations I'd done. These enhancements can enhance your home's value, so make sure to incorporate them. Pricing slightly below market value can attract more potential buyers, making your property stand out in a competitive market.

It's also a good idea to seek advice from a real estate agent or a mobile home specialist. Their expertise can provide invaluable insights into establishing a price that's both competitive and fair. They can assist you in navigating the intricacies of the Elk Grove market, ensuring you don't undervalue your property.

Preparing Necessary Documentation

capturing specific text details

Gathering the necessary documentation is essential to ensuring a smooth and successful sale of your mobile home in Elk Grove. When you're ready to attract potential mobile home buyers, you need to have all your paperwork in order.

Start by locating the title, as this proves your ownership and is vital for the transfer process. Make sure the title is updated and accurate to avoid any hiccups down the line.

Next, prepare a bill of sale. This document outlines the terms of the sale and provides a legal record of the transaction. If you have any warranties for your mobile home, gather these as well to offer additional assurance to buyers.

Don't forget the mobile home's registration and any relevant permits. These documents are often required in CA and can expedite the selling process.

Keep a detailed record of any maintenance or repairs you've done. This shows the mobile home's condition and can be a persuasive tool when buyers are comparing options.

Lastly, create a thorough list of any appliances or furnishings included in the sale. This can make your listing more attractive and provide clarity for those searching for a CA Sell My Mobile opportunity.

Finalizing the Sale Agreement

finalizing real estate transaction

Finalizing the sale agreement is important to guarantee both parties are clear about the terms and conditions of the mobile home transaction. A well-drafted sale agreement should include detailed information to avoid any misunderstandings down the road. Here's what you need to cover:

  • Mobile home details: Include specifics about the mobile home, such as its make, model, and serial number.
  • Sale price and furnishings: Clearly state the agreed-upon sale price and list any furnishings or appliances included in the sale.
  • Closing date and contingencies: Specify the closing date and outline any conditions that need to be met before the sale can be finalized.

I strongly recommend considering the assistance of a real estate attorney. Having a professional review and finalize the sale agreement ensures that all legal protections are in place. This step can save you from potential legal disputes later.

Both the buyer and I need to sign the sale agreement to make it legally binding. It's also important to retain copies of the signed agreement for both parties' records. This documentation serves as a reference point and can be invaluable should any questions or issues arise in the future.
